Nova Scotians love to get together and celebrate their communities with festivals and events all year round. From Halifax’s Busker Festival to the Acadian Festival in Clare, Cape Breton’s Festival of Colours, Chester Race Week and more. This past summer and fall working with Nova Scotia tourism I made my way around from Lunenburg to Cape Breton to some of the smaller and lesser known events. Not only did I have a blast, but I learned more about my home and met some great people along the way.
Here is a guide to some of the great Nova Scotia community festivals and events that I attended this summer:
Nicolas Denys Days in St. Peter's Cape Breton
Festival de l’Escaouette in Cheticamp, Cape Breton
Nova Scotia Folk Art Festival in Lunenburg
Clam Harbour Beach Sand Castle Competition in Clam Harbour
Halifax County Exhibition in Middle Musquodoboit
